For the Love of God
“He that hath my commandments, and keepeth them, he it is that loveth me: and he that loveth me shall be loved of my Father, and I will love him, and will manifest myself to him.” John 14:21
Has God called you to do something really hard? To stay in a marriage that’s really painful? To stay away from someone who’s not walking according to God’s ways? To give up something or someone you desperately want? To stay in a job you want to leave? To sacrifice a big income and benefits to do something else for Him? To forgive someone you want to hate forever? To reach out to someone in love you have pride-fully looked down on? To help someone you would rather hurt? To turn away from an opportunity that is deliciously tempting? To do something so challenging you can’t even imagine being able to do it – except in His strength? To start sharing the Gospel with people despite how shy and scared you are? Is there something God has called you to do, or not do, that no matter how hard you try to pretend it’s not there, it’s right in your face? Like repenting of your sins, believing in Christ as Lord, and giving your life wholly to God and His ways? Something, whatever it is, no matter how great or small, that you just know in your heart God’s Spirit has placed on your heart to do or not do in obedience to Him?
I am in a phenomenally long, grueling, emotionally and physically challenging season of my life following Christ, and every ounce of my flesh wants to QUIT, RUN, HIDE, anything but persevere. But persevering is EXACTLY what I am doing. I am CHOOSING to cry out to God, to seek His face, and to OBEY GOD. For ONE SINGLE REASON. Because I love God more than anything or anyone in the universe. I used to think of obedience as a punishment, a bondage, an obligation. Now I know the truth. Obedience is a breathtakingly amazing opportunity to LOVE GOD, to SERVE GOD, to REVERE GOD, to WORSHIP GOD, to HONOR GOD, to EXALT GOD, to MAGNIFY GOD, to THANK GOD, to DRAW CLOSER TO GOD, to TELL THE WORLD ABOUT GOD, and to EXPERIENCE THE JOY AND BLESSING AND PRIVILEGE AND HUMBLING HONOR of being His daughter and His servant who wants nothing more than to LOVE HIM FOREVER! God gives me the strength and grace to obey Him and to persevere, to deny my flesh that wants to quit, to carry my little cross, and to follow Jesus my Lord forever!
Whatever God is calling you to do, or not do, please obey Him. Obey Him because you love Him. Jesus said those who keep His commandments love Him. Instead of seeing obedience as a hardship, see it as an opportunity to love and revere and honor the Lord forever! For the love of God, obey Him!
